As the warmer weather and the summer heat has finally arrived, fans have been given a wonderful ‘welcome to spring season’ treat as the K-Pop sensation Red Velvet also coined as the ‘spring queens’ dropped its newest mini-album, “The ReVe Festival 2022- Feel My Rhythm”, on March 21 at 6 p.m KST.

Scenting the season with their much-awaited comeback, the group composed of Irene, Seulgi, Wendy, Joy, and Yeri released a dreamy music video for the title track that leaves fans in awe not only with the group’s concept but with the overflowing visuals, vocals and dance the group has unveiled mesmerizingly on the music video.

“Feel My Rhythm”, the group’s title track is a pop dance song that showcases a tale of the girls’ fun-filled and free journey, traveling across time and space while following where the music takes them using their imagination- a theme that takes the center stage for Red Velvet’s 2022 mini-album “ReVe” that is translated to “dreaming”.

With their newest album, the K-pop stars joined the lists of other K-pop acts to join the ranks of “half million sellers”, as the group’s ‘Feel My Rhythm’ became a bestseller even before its release.

Hitting another milestone this season, Red Velvet ‘The ReVe Festival 2022 – Feel My Rhythm’ is also taking over New York at New York Times Square, sending fans delighted over the girl group’s another addition to their achievements.

Marking Red Velvet’s first comeback since “Queendom” mini-album last year, ‘The ReVe Festival 2022 – Feel My Rhythm’ is a six-track album with the following songs: “Feel My Rhythm”, “Rainbow Halo”, “Beg For Me”, Bamboleo”, Good, Bad, Ugly,” and “In My Dreams”.

“The ReVe Festival 2022” is Red Velvet’s latest installment of “The ReVe Festival” series. The group released three parts of “The ReVe Festival” series in 2019: “The ReVe Festival Day 1,” “The ReVe Festival Day 2,” and “The ReVe Festival Finale.”
